Election Reform Bans Abuse With Election Process

Election Reform Bans Abuse With Election Process

Political subjects are lacking the will to finalise election reform, which was launched eight years ago. Thus, they assess connoisseurs of political issues, who stress that with legislation in place, parties are more likely to manipulate the election process. Even the representative of the Democratic League of Kosovo in the Central Election Commission, Florian Dushi, has indicated that the main obstacle to completing electoral reform is the lack of political will in a part of the parties.

He says the LDK has been pro-creating an election reform since 2010.

“in the absence of electoral reform we have a process like this with which they're manipulating specific segments at the lowest level, which have perfected manipulation or abuse. This thing is then causing extensions of the process to correct it. So, it's good after these elections to have a process with an election reform”, Dushi has declared for “Zrin“.

He has mentioned some of the key problems that would be avoided by electoral reform.

The key problem is the one on the ground on election day. Those nominated by political subjects on Election Day practically do not carry out the work in accordance with the law, the word is mainly counting, describing results, voting and everything else. With an election reform, I believe it would be possible to remove these problems”, the Dushi has posted.
